If activation energy, Ea of the reaction is equal to RT then

A

The rate of reaction will be independent on initial

concentration of reactant.

B

The rate constant becomes approximately equal to 37% of

the Arrhenius constant

C

The rate of reaction becomes infinite

D

The rate of reaction always be first order.

Answer

The rate constant becomes approximately equal to 37% of

the Arrhenius constant

Explanation

Solution

k = A eEa/RTe^{- E_{a}/RT}

When Ea = RT, then k = Ae\frac{A}{e} = A2.718\frac{A}{2.718} ~ 0.37 A
